Are these LE1/LE2 heads?
Even with that small cam it should make peak HP at 6100 RPM (2.15" pushrod pinch and 2.00 over shortside) unless there is something going on making it peak sooner (rocker adjustment, A/F ratio, timing, ingition, etc).
If they are not our heads, they could just be a lil smaller in these areas and that is what is making it peak sooner.
